Full Job Description
Job Overview

The Regional Pricing Analyst plays a critical role in driving profitable growth across substation and transmission markets through strategic, data-driven pricing decisions. This role operates with a high degree of autonomy, independently evaluating opportunities, making pricing decisions, and driving actions that directly impact business outcomes. Working closely with Sales, Marketing, Customer Service, and Business Unit leadership, this role supports high-value opportunities, enhances win rates, and strengthens competitive positioning while leading pricing decisions and implementing strategic initiatives.

In this role, you will serve as the pricing expert, independently leading pricing strategy for complex projects and proactively shaping go-to-market approaches. You will guide the organization on market dynamics, cost drivers, and competitive insights, translating analysis into actionable strategies. Your work will directly shape pricing outcomes on large-scale bids and drive long-term business performance through decisive leadership and strong execution.

About Hubbell Inc

Hubbell Incorporated is an American company that designs, manufactures, and sells electrical and electronic products for non-residential and residential construction, industrial, and utility applications. Hubbell was founded by Harvey Hubbell as a proprietorship in 1888, and was incorporated in Connecticut in 1905. It is ranked 602 by Fortune. The company’s reporting segments consist of the electrical segment and the Power segment. Hubbell’s manufacturing facilities are located in the United States, Canada, Switzerland, Puerto Rico, Mexico, the People's Republic of China, Italy, the United Kingdom, Brazil and Australia and maintains sales offices in Singapore, China, India, Mexico, South Korea, and countries in the Middle East. Hubbell was previously headquartered in Orange, Connecticut, and has now moved its headquarters to Shelton, Connecticut. Hubbell Inc. assisted Allied efforts during World War II by manufacturing military vehicle electrical circuits, battery-charging systems for M4 Sherman tanks, power jacks for test meters, vacuum tube sockets for radio communications, and a line of electrical and electronic connectors for aircraft. Hubbell Inc. is in List of S&P 400 companies having stocks that are included in the S&P 400 stock market index, maintained by S&P Dow Jones Indices.
